BY Kathleen Stock / 6 mins
BY Jonathan Wilson / 7 mins
BY Jonathan Wilson / 6 mins
BY Pratinav Anil / 8 mins
BY Jonathan Wilson / 5 mins
BY Tobias Jones / 8 mins
BY David Patrikarakos / 6 mins
BY Kathleen Stock / 5 mins
BY Wessie du Toit / 6 mins